SANTA FE, N.M. (AP) - Federal and local authorities are searching for a man who allegedly robbed a Santa Fe bank at gunpoint.
FBI spokesman Frank Fisher says the suspect walked into Century Bank on Friday around 4 p.m. and showed a handgun to an employee.
The suspect then allegedly jumped on a counter, opened a teller drawer and grabbed an undisclosed amount of cash before fleeing.
Witnesses say he was Hispanic, in his 20s and around 5-foot-4.
He was wearing glasses, a black hooded jacket, blue jeans and dark blue or black shoes.
Anyone with information is asked to contact the FBI.
The agency is offering a reward of up to $1,000 for information leading to an arrest and conviction.
